卫星追踪、AI监测,我国护鸟手段持续升级,记者探访→
Sou Hu Cai Jing· 2025-11-27 11:10
Core Viewpoint - During the "14th Five-Year Plan" period, China's bird protection efforts have significantly upgraded their technological methods, transitioning from extensive management to precise strategies, which has notably improved population analysis and migratory bird tracking accuracy [1]. Group 1: Technological Advancements - The introduction of satellite trackers powered by solar energy allows for real-time recording of bird location, body temperature, flight altitude, and speed, with data retrieval as fast as once per second under good lighting conditions [5]. - Over 40 bird monitoring stations in Beijing have adopted voiceprint and image recognition technology, utilizing artificial intelligence and big data analysis to monitor bird species and populations based on their appearance and sounds [7]. - Drones have emerged as a powerful auxiliary monitoring tool in complex terrains and wetlands that are difficult for humans to access [9]. Group 2: Rehabilitation and Release Efforts - A specific case involved a rescued buzzard that was rehabilitated and prepared for release during the migratory season, equipped with a satellite tracker that adheres to a global standard of not exceeding 5% of the bird's body weight [3]. - The tracking data from released birds aids in evaluating the effectiveness of rehabilitation and release efforts, providing insights into their activity patterns and habitat preferences [5].

Core Viewpoint - The strategic collaboration between Philips and Masimo in patient monitoring signifies a shift towards integrated solutions in the medical device industry, highlighting the importance of partnerships to meet clinical demands for comprehensive healthcare solutions [1][6]. Collaboration Content and Focus - Philips and Masimo will deepen their collaboration through technology integration, focusing on enhancing patient monitoring capabilities [2]. - The partnership aims to develop next-generation patient monitoring solutions that address the clinical needs for mobility, wearability, and intelligence, incorporating AI algorithms for improved patient outcomes [5]. Product Features and Collaborative Foundations - Philips has a strong presence in multi-parameter patient monitoring devices, particularly in high-acuity settings, while Masimo specializes in non-invasive sensors and innovative monitoring parameters [4]. - Key technologies include Masimo's SET pulse oximetry technology and Radius PPG wearable sensors, which will be integrated into Philips' monitoring systems [4][5]. Insights for Domestic Manufacturers - Domestic companies often excel in specific innovations but may struggle to scale without partnerships with larger firms. Finding complementary partners to embed innovations into comprehensive solutions is crucial for growth [9]. - Mindray serves as a representative example of a domestic firm that integrates sensors, algorithms, and monitoring platforms internally, adopting a "full-stack self-research" model [9]. Areas Suitable for Collaboration - The medical device industry is moving towards systematic strategies for collaboration, emphasizing the need for integrated solutions rather than isolated innovations [6][10]. - Collaborations can enhance market efficiency, shorten the path from R&D to market, and facilitate access to reimbursement and regulatory approvals [10]. Areas Unsuitable for Collaboration - Direct competition in core devices, such as ventilators and surgical robots, may hinder collaboration due to potential dilution of competitive advantages [11]. - Areas with severe product homogeneity or conflicting business models may also present challenges for effective partnerships [11]. Future Observations - The trend of collaboration among multinational companies to quickly address market gaps may influence domestic firms to consider open partnerships in emerging fields like AI and wearable sensors [12].
